Lets compare vitamin content per 300 calories of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ds vs Canned Red Sweet Peppers with Liquids:
300 calories of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ds have 5.6 times more Vitamin B5 than Canned Red Sweet Peppers with Liquids.
While 300 kcal of Canned Red Sweet Peppers Solids and Liquids contain more Vitamin A, 2.6 times more Vitamin B1, 3.5 times more Vitamin B2, 4.4 times more Vitamin B3, 7.4 times more Vitamin B6, 2.2 times more Vitamin B9 and 1390.3 times more Vitamin C than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els.
300 calories of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A and Vitamin C
Both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els as well as Canned Red Sweet Peppers Solids and Liquids have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 300 calories.
Comparing minerals per 300 calories for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ds vs Canned Red Sweet Peppers with Liquids:
300 calories of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ds have 1.7 times more Phosphorus and 7.9 times more Selenium than Canned Red Sweet Peppers with Liquids.
While 300 kcal of Canned Red Sweet Peppers Solids and Liquids contain 15.5 times more Calcium, 2.4 times more Copper, 6.1 times more Iron, 2.8 times more Magnesium, 2.5 times more Manganese, 9.9 times more Potassium, 15008.3 times more Sodium and 1948.8 times more Water than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els.
Both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ds and Canned Red Sweet Peppers with Liquids contain similar levels of Zinc per 300 calories.
300 calories of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ds lack sufficient amounts of Calcium
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 300 calories:
300 calories of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ds have 5.2 times more Fat, 4.8 times more Saturated Fat and 7.1 times more Omega 6 than Canned Red Sweet Peppers with Liquids.
While 300 kcal of Canned Red Sweet Peppers Solids and Liquids contain 6.1 times more Omega 3, 5.6 times more Carbohydrate, 3.7 times more Fiber and 1.3 times more Protein than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els.
Both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ds and Canned Red Sweet Peppers with Liquids offer comparable quantities of Energy per 300 calories.
300 calories of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3
